What is the GHS hazard classification for C.I. Solvent Yellow 14?
C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 (CAS 842-07-9) is classified under EU CLP Annex VI as Carc. 2; Muta. 2; Skin Sens. 1; Aquatic Chronic 4 with signal word Warning. Hazard statements: H351; H341; H317; H413. Source: EU CLP Annex VI (ECHA).

Is C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 a carcinogen according to IARC?
C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 is classified by IARC as Group 3 — not classifiable as to its carcinogenicity to humans (evaluated 1987). Source: IARC Monographs on the Identification of Carcinogenic Hazards to Humans.
Is C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 on the California Proposition 65 list?
Yes, C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 is listed under California Proposition 65 for cancer. Source: California OEHHA Proposition 65.

Does C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 have different safety status in cosmetics vs industrial chemicals?
C.I. Solvent Yellow 14 is prohibited in EU cosmetics but has active industrial GHS classifications (H351, H341, H317, H413).
